China Center for Information Industry Development (CCID) has just presented its 15th crypto rating.

According to the latest ranking, the largest cryptocurrency by market cap has climbed from position 11 to 9, entering the top 10 for the first time. It must be noted that EOS holds the first position.

iHodl has recently reported Weiss Ratings has downgraded the EOS project rating from "B" to "C-". According to the firm, it has decided to do so as a result of the excessive centralization of the project. 100 leading holders of EOS tokens, accounting for 0.01% of the total, control 68% of the vote.

In the second position of the ranking we can find ethereum, which has managed to bypass TRON.

Qtum, which jumped several positions in the previous version of the ranking, has now lost 6 positions, falling from the 8th to the 14th place.

Even though the CIID belongs to the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ology of China, there is not any official link between the raking and the official position of the country's authorities.
